James McCallum (Clowman Craven Evans Cycling RT) was a surprise winner of the elite race in tonight's Otley Cycling Club National Criterium Championship.

He finished ahead of Ed Clancy (Lambrow Credit) and Matthew Cronshaw (Scienceinsport-Trek).

The evening's entertainment began with the senior race, which attracted around 90 entries.

West Yorkshire Police's Damian Sharpe won a sprint finish to pip Daniel Birch (Obri Coaching RT). James Farnaby (Crosstrax RT) from Otley finished fifth.

There was also a five-kilometre athletics race, which was won by Ian Fisher (Otley Athletics Club). He also won a road race last Wednesday in Otley.
